AUCKLAND HOTELS.
Telegraph Press Association Copyright Auckland, Dec 5. At the quarterly sitting of the Auckland Licensing Committee this morning, Mr Rosser remarked that there were 58 hotels in the district, and very little fault to find. He had just returned from a trip to the South, and considered that Auckland hotels compared very favorably with those elsewhere. Mr Aickin : " The hotels are a credit to the city and the police." Mr Dyer : " Considering the population of the city and the number of hotels taking them on the whole they are very well conducted." The president concluded the discussion by remarking that there must be infringements of the Act sometimes, but the police deserved credit for being very much on the alert. _^___
